POSITION SUMMARY

Floor Supervisors are brand ambassadors responsible for creating an emotional connection between our customers and the brand. They assist with leading the effort to exceed expectations, provide exceptional service and display passion for our brand. Floor Supervisors are part of the store management team focused delivering top line sales results.

RESPONSIBILITIES
Customer Experience
  • Leads the effort to greet and offer assistance to every customer; provides real-time coaching to associates.
  • Executes replenishment ensuring sales floor inventory levels and size availability aligns with brand standards; collaborates with management on remerchandising decisions due to sell-through and available backstock.
  • Encourages and helps associates maintain an in-depth knowledge of product and promotions to help explain value and build brand loyalty.
  • Prioritizes delivering an exceptional customer experience throughout the store and always places our customer first; asks our customers for feedback and conveys business opportunities to the Store Manager.
  • Resolves customer concerns quickly while exceeding expectations.
Commitment to Efficiency
  • Leads the execution of shipment processing, replenishment, pricing, and visual / marketing directives in alignment with brand standards; achieves or exceeds the brand’s UPH processing standards.
  • Assists in leading merchandising execution, filling in based on sell-through and collaborating with management on new arrival merchandising decisions.
  • Enforces all company tools, policies and procedures; assists with loss prevention training and coaches associates to maintain awareness and report concerns.
  • Assists with effective scheduling to support payroll strategies and budgets.
Associate Morale
  • Motivates and inspires associates to achieve sales goals and uphold brand standards; contributes to the recruiting and onboarding of talent to ensure a best-in‑class team.
  • Demonstrates a sense of pride, commitment, and passion for the brand and our customers; treats customers and store team professionally, courteously, and respectfully.
  • Celebrates and embraces individuality, inclusion and partnership; builds relationships and seeks out feedback for continuous self‑development.
  • Embraces innovation, change, and company initiatives; works collaboratively to accomplish brand goals and objectives.
QUALIFICATIONS
  • Minimum of 2 years of retail experience required.
  • High school graduate / equivalent preferred.
  • Flexible schedule required including nights, weekends and overnight shifts; some travel may be requested.
  • Excellent communication and time management skills.
  • Ability to walk, stand, bend, reach and squat for prolonged periods, and carry up to 20 pounds.
